Pros

Okay work life balance, average benefits, work can be interesting with right contact but those opportunities can be hard to come by.

Cons

Management is not transparent, most policies are 20 years old and little information is given on how to advance, when new management spots were opened there was no competition they were handed out to favorites. Low pay due to aggressive bidding on contacts, people have been asked to donate hours in the past because contacts were underbid to win.

Pros

The company provides very good benefits - the retirement plans are better than the industry, the salary is quite competitive. Lot of the employees have been around for a long time, so they are knowledgeable about any issues that crop up.

Cons

The company management lacks long term vision. The company culture is bit insular, you don't get to know much what the other divisions are doing - even though there can be some expertise overlap across divisions there is hardly any collaboration. The retirement plans have a very long vesting period.
